    Document: In turn, the RNAi technology has yielded significant insights into virus-host interactions, such as the identification of the ion transporter NRAMP as the receptor for the mosquito-borne Sindbis virus colonization of Drosophila cells [41] . The main power of the RNAi technology is that it allows high throughput genome-wide screens and therefore potential identification of essential factors that play roles in different aspects of the pathogen life cycle, including initial interaction with the host cell. Although RNAi screens have provided tremendous insights into host-pathogen interactions and remain widely utilized [121] , inefficient gene depletion and off-target effects are important limitations of this methodology [122] .
